Perpetually popular, this visible-from-a-mile “classic” daylily is a fabulous backdrop or commercial variety for its stature, a full 3-feet when in bloom, and great quantity of huge, richly bittersweet orange, tawny overlaid petals of heavy substance and crimped edges. Care

Watering:

'Rocket City' Daylily is moderately drought tolerant but benefits from occasional watering, to maintain soil in a moist but not wet condition, during the summer months.

Fertilizing:

'Rocket City' Daylily is a moderate feeder, benefiting from a couple of annual applications of slow release fertilizer. A spring application of a 3-1-2 ratio (such as a 15-5-10) can be applied at a rate of about 10 pounds per 1000 square feet, and during early fall, an application of a 2-1-2 ratio (such as a 10-5-10) can be applied to encourage root development and cold hardiness.

Pruning:

'Rocket City' Daylily should be enjoyed all winter long, then, during early April before it begins to grow again, it should be pruned or mowed back to ground level.
